Balcony removal services involve the professional dismantling and disposal of existing balconies on residential or commercial properties. This process typically includes carefully removing the structure, ensuring that the surrounding areas are protected from debris, and properly disposing of or recycling the materials. Contractors may also assess the underlying structure to confirm that it remains stable and safe after the balcony is removed, especially if the removal is part of a larger renovation or building modification project.

Removing a balcony can help address several common issues. It is often undertaken to eliminate safety hazards caused by deteriorating or damaged structures that pose a risk of collapse or injury. Additionally, balcony removal may be necessary when planning to update or expand outdoor living spaces, or when the existing balcony no longer aligns with the property's aesthetic or functional goals. Removing an unused or unsafe balcony can also improve the overall appearance of a building, making it more visually appealing and potentially increasing property value.

This service is frequently used on a variety of property types, including multi-family apartment buildings, condominiums, and single-family homes. Older properties with balconies that have experienced wear and tear are common candidates for removal. Commercial buildings may also require balcony removal during renovations or repurposing projects, especially if the balconies no longer meet safety standards or building codes. Cost Range for Balcony Removal - The typical cost for removing a balcony varies between $2,000 and $8,000, depending on size and complexity. For example, a small balcony might cost around $2,500, while larger or more intricate structures could reach $7,500 or more.

Factors Affecting Pricing - Factors such as balcony material, accessibility, and the extent of structural work influence the overall cost. Demolition of concrete balconies generally costs more, often between $4,000 and $10,000, compared to wooden structures.

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include debris removal, site preparation, and repair of the underlying surface,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total price. These expenses vary based on the project's scope and local contractor rates.

Cost Estimates for Local Areas - In Hollis, NH, balcony removal services typically fall within the $3,000 to $9,000 range. Prices in nearby areas may fluctuate based on the local market and spec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
